Hawk Tuah Meme Coin Drama Resurfaces

After months of silence following her disastrous Solana meme coin launch, Hailey Welch, better known as the “Hawk Tuah” girl, has resurfaced—but things are just as chaotic as before.

Welch appeared in a new episode of her “Talk Tuah” podcast on Thursday, marking her first major public appearance since the HAWK token debacle in early December. However, the episode was mysteriously deleted soon after it went live, adding another layer of confusion to an already messy saga.

But the internet is fast—leaks of the episode are now circulating on social media, ensuring that Welch’s unexpected return remains under the spotlight.

Welch, FaZe Banks, and the Leaked Podcast

The scrubbed episode featured Welch speaking with FaZe Clan co-founder Richard “FaZe Banks” Bengtson, DeGods creator Frank (Rohun Vora), and crypto content creator Threadguy.

Welch recounted how she got involved in launching a meme coin, only to realize the deployer controlled 80% of the supply, causing its price to immediately crash to near-zero. She admitted she’s still “a little shook up” over the ordeal.

In the podcast, Welch suggested she wasn’t fully aware of what she was getting into, a claim her guests seemed to agree with. Meanwhile, Welch is cooperating with lawyers in a lawsuit against her former business partners, whom she appears to hold responsible for the failed project.

FaZe Banks Reacts: “What a Mess”

Following the leak, FaZe Banks took to X (formerly Twitter) to distance himself from the situation, claiming he had agreed to the interview under strict conditions.

Banks alleged that Welch’s team had promised the episode wouldn’t be released without approval, but after hearing rumors about the podcast being published, he and his team pulled the plug.

Yet, the episode still surfaced online—and the price of the HAWK token briefly pumped before cooling down.

“Now today, the episode ‘randomly’ gets leaked. The price of HAWK is pumping and they completely fumbled the bag, yet again,” Banks wrote. “What a fucking mess. Poor girl, it’s a wonder how she found herself in this position in the first place.”

Hawk Tuah Token Surges, Then Falls

As soon as news of the podcast leaked, the HAWK token more than doubled in price, fueled by speculation. However, the hype faded quickly, and HAWK is now up just 9% on the day, currently trading at $0.00071, according to CoinMarketCap.
